About The 85 At Scott Road
The 85 At Scott Road offers modern lowrise living in the heart of Queen Mary Park Surrey, one of Surrey's most established and family-friendly neighborhoods. This brand-new 2023 wood-frame development at 8496 120 Street combines contemporary design with the charm of a mature community known for its tree-lined streets and proximity to excellent amenities. Residents enjoy easy access to Scott Road's diverse dining and shopping options, including numerous authentic restaurants and specialty stores. The location provides convenient transit connections along the Scott Road corridor, making commutes to Vancouver and other Metro Vancouver destinations effortless. Queen Mary Park Surrey is renowned for its proximity to quality schools, parks, and recreational facilities, including the nearby Hawthorne Park and community center. This newer construction ensures modern building standards, energy efficiency, and contemporary finishes, making it an ideal choice for first-time buyers, young professionals, and families seeking affordable urban living with a neighborhood feel in one of Surrey's most connected communities.

Investor Insights — Condos in Queen Mary Park Surrey
Estimated rental yields based on MLS data for condos in Queen Mary Park Surrey.
| Type | Beds | Avg Rent | Avg Sale | Strata | Net Yield |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Condo | 1 | $1,740/mo | $375,310 | $370/mo | 3.6% |
| Condo | 2 | $2,187/mo | $429,963 | $411/mo | 4.1% |
Net yield accounts for strata fees, property tax, and insurance. View full analysis
